SC extended public offer deadline to 12.02.2025, contingent on appellant depositing 600 crores per SEBI Regulations by specified date. Key dispute centered on determining public announcement date under Regulation 20(1) - whether 18.01.2025 or 03.10.2023. Court mandated that if deposit requirement is met, offer will continue until third day after SEBI's ruling on pending application. Original respondents had previously deposited 330 crores in escrow. Court preserved rights of aggrieved parties to seek appropriate remedies following SEBI's determination on announcement date, exemption eligibility, and offer price issues. Order specified as interim in nature.
